Summary


On May 1, 2012, Halifax Volunteer Fire Department responded to a hazmat incident at Maple Ave, Halifax, VA 24558, a street.

The alarm was received at 4:00 PM, 8 suppression personnel arrived at 4:03 PM, the incident was controlled at 4:30 PM, and the last unit was cleared at 4:45 PM. The time to arrive was 3 minutes, the time to control the incident was 27 minutes, and the total incident time was 45 minutes.

The following actions were taken during the incident: investigate, refer to proper authority, and control traffic.
